Central Railways To Add Panic Switches At 117 Stations

Central Railway is implementing a comprehensive safety plan to enhance passenger security. The plan involves installing panic switches at 117 stations across the network, enabling passengers to quickly alert the Railway Protection Force (RPF) in emergencies. Additionally, all ladies coaches in Mumbai's local trains will be equipped with emergency talkback systems and CCTV cameras by March 2024. Currently, 512 ladies coaches have emergency talkback systems, and 421 have CCTV cameras. This initiative reflects Central Railway's commitment to safeguarding passengers, especially women, across its vast network, which includes 1850 suburban services, 145 DEMU-MEMU trains, and 371 mail-express trains, including high-speed Vande Bharat Express trains.
